...vaccine fears persist in part because parents often notice the first autism symptoms around age 2, when many childhood vaccines are given. Most autism experts believe this is purely coincidental and that in many cases, parents have missed subtle signs of autism--like a baby's failure to point or use other gestures to communicate--that may have emerged before vaccination...
